Italian
Etymology
From storno (“a starling”) + -ello (forming diminutives). Compare French étourneau.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/storˈnɛl.lo/
- Rhymes: -ɛllo
- Hyphenation: stor‧nèl‧lo
Noun
stornello m (plural stornelli)
- (rare) diminutive of storno (“a starling”)
